Merge remote-tracking branch 'origin/master'
This commit is contained in:
@@ -1,7 +1,11 @@
|
||||
#!/bin/bash
|
||||
set -euo pipefail
|
||||
|
||||
export NODE_OPTIONS="--max_old_space_size=2048"
|
||||
export NODE_OPTIONS="--max_old_space_size=4096"
|
||||
export CI="true"
|
||||
export npm_config_progress="false"
|
||||
export npm_config_loglevel="warn"
|
||||
export FORCE_COLOR="0"
|
||||
LOG_FILE="/var/log/bssapp_deploy.log"
|
||||
APP_DIR="/opt/bssapp"
|
||||
LOCK_FILE="/tmp/bssapp_deploy.lock"
|
||||
@@ -19,9 +23,6 @@ run_deploy() {
|
||||
|
||||
cd "$APP_DIR"
|
||||
|
||||
echo "== STOP SERVICE =="
|
||||
systemctl stop bssapp
|
||||
|
||||
echo "== GIT SYNC =="
|
||||
git fetch origin
|
||||
git reset --hard origin/master
|
||||
@@ -29,11 +30,11 @@ run_deploy() {
|
||||
|
||||
echo "== BUILD UI =="
|
||||
cd ui
|
||||
npm install --no-audit --no-fund
|
||||
npm ci --no-audit --no-fund
|
||||
npm run build
|
||||
|
||||
echo "== START SERVICE =="
|
||||
systemctl start bssapp
|
||||
echo "== RESTART SERVICE =="
|
||||
systemctl restart bssapp
|
||||
|
||||
echo "[DEPLOY FINISHED] $(date '+%F %T')"
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user